Great news from Flywheel.
We are bringing the one-two punch of advanced academic studies and lived experience in diversity, equity, and inclusion to our Elevate Equity program with the addition of Latavia Walker as Program Manager. Latvia will also be designing additional entrepreneurship success programming to address the unique needs of underrepresented founders as we explore new ways to support social entrepreneurs in our community.
Latavia is a Doctoral candidate at Northern Kentucky University in Educational Leadership with an emphasis in Social Justice. Prior to joining Flywheel, she was with Sinclair Community College developing programming to support success for first-generation college students from underserved communities. She is also an accomplished photographer running her own business so she knows first hand about entrepreneurship. Latavia is inspired by the opportunity to leverage entrepreneurship to reduce bias and increase inclusion. She starts January 3rd.
We are currently planning our Elevate Equity accelerator for early to mid-stage startups addressing systemic race and/or gender bias through some aspect of their business model. If you or someone you know would be interested in our program starting in early March and lasting 8 weeks, please check out our website for more information. We will start taking applications after the new year but I am happy to talk to founders now.
We are also recruiting coaches for this special cohort. If you or someone you know may be motivated to support Black and women led startups, we would would enjoy the opportunity to speak with you. Coaches receive training in the coaching mindset and lean startups. They meet with founders about 2-3 hours a week during the accelerator.
